2009 Statistics Outstanding Alumna: Marcey L. Hoover

Dr. Marcey Hoover is Manager of the Strategic Planning & Laboratory Leadership Team (LLT) at Sandia National Laboratories. Sandia is operated for the U.S. Department of Energy's National Nuclear Security Administration (NNSA) by Lockheed Martin Corporation.

The Strategic Planning & LLT department is responsible for organizing and executing the corporate level strategic planning activities and laboratory leadership forums, as well as helping to increase the analytical basis through system studies of issues that directly affect laboratory strategy. In this role, Marcey is responsible for coordinating and facilitating the executive management team meetings on strategy and management of the Laboratories, authoring and maintaining the institution's strategic plan, and overseeing the management of the corporate objectives, goals, and milestones. She is also Sandia's deputy campus executive for Purdue University.

In the past, Hoover managed stockpile evaluation programs for bombs, cruise missiles, and non-nuclear components at Sandia. In these roles, her organizations were responsible for statistically sampling weapons from the nation's nuclear stockpile, conducting tests in a laboratory or flight environment, analyzing the data, and investigating any anomalies disclosed by the data. The testing and investigation, in coordination with other assessment and certification efforts, helped to ensure the health and performance of the overall stockpile. Prior to these assignments, Hoover provided technical management and systems engineering support to various nuclear weapon programs, and led efforts to implement formal risk and cost management practices at Sandia.

In addition to assignments at Sandia, Hoover was previously a Certified Quality Engineer and member of the ASQ Statistics Division, serving as a Short Course Chair for two Annual Quality Congresses, the Electronic Commerce Chair, and two terms as the elected Division Treasurer. She has also held elected positions in the American Statistical Association (ASA) and served as a Technometrics book reviewer.

Hoover holds an M.S. (1993) and Ph.D. (1995) in Mathematical Statistics from Purdue University and a B.S. in Mathematics from Michigan State University.
